The Town of Bentley is working with Associated Engineering to undertake a re-design of 50th Street (otherwise known as Dick Damron Drive) to a full urban standard between 50th avenue and 55th avenue. This includes improvement and replacement of aging roadway, sidewalks, and landscaping as well as utility infrastructure along this important corridor. We are at the beginning of the process and are looking at the functionality of the roadway and are looking for resident input to inform the functional design. A survey was issued to gather feedback to help inform that design and that survey is now closed. The input gathered will be utilized to finalize conceptual design and will help to determine order of magnitude cost estimates. This is a large project for Bentley and will take time to complete, the intention is to seek out grant funding to help support implementation of the project in future years.

The vision is for the corridor to become a gathering and entertainment district with enhanced streetscaping to improve the experience of residents and visitors. Our consultant is working to finalize the conceptual design package and it will be presented to Mayor and Council at a future public council meeting, once administration has had time to review the finalized concept plan.
